Undergraduate Tuition & Fees
The following table compares 2023-2024 undergraduate tuition & fees between selected colleges. The average undergraduate tuition & fees is $32,085 for all students. The 2023-2024 undergraduate tuition & fees of selected colleges are increased by 3.67% compared to the previous year.
Among the selected colleges, Minneapolis College of Art and Design requires the most expensive tuition & fees of $43,824 and Martin Luther College has the lowest tuition & fees of $17,770 for undergraduate programs.
Name | 2022-2023 | 2023-2024 | ||
---|---|---|---|---|
In-State | Out-of-State | In-State | Out-of-State | |
Dunwoody College of Technology | $24,611 | $25,659 | ||
Saint Mary's University of Minnesota | $41,150 | $43,160 | ||
Minneapolis College of Art and Design | $42,560 | $43,824 | ||
Martin Luther College | $17,420 | $17,770 | ||
Bethany Lutheran College | $29,010 | $30,010 | ||
Average | $30,950 | $32,085 |

Room & Board, Other Living Expenses
The following table compares living costs including room, board, and other expenses between selected colleges. Each cost is in average and may vary by room types, meal plan, and other living styles. For academic year 2023-2024, the average living costs of selected colleges is $12,988 when a student lives on campus and $12,988 when living off campus.
Name | On-Campus | Off-Campus | |||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Room & Board | Other Expenses | Room & Board | Other Expenses | Other Expenses (living with family) | |
Dunwoody College of Technology | $14,659 | $3,600 | $14,659 | $3,600 | - |
Saint Mary's University of Minnesota | $10,720 | $1,900 | $10,720 | $1,900 | - |
Minneapolis College of Art and Design | $10,910 | $2,000 | $10,910 | $2,000 | - |
Martin Luther College | $7,280 | $3,600 | $7,280 | $3,600 | - |
Bethany Lutheran College | $8,270 | $2,000 | $8,270 | $2,000 | - |
Average | $10,368 | $2,620 | $10,368 | $2,620 | - |
